Implementation of Cloud-based Load Distribution Model in Information-Centric Networking based Wireless Sensor Networks

Abstract(in English) We have proposed an Information-Centric Networking (ICN) -based Wireless Sensor Networks Platform (ICSNP), which applies ICN as a Sensor Network to realize multiple IoT Services. However, when ICSNP is operated in an environment where multiple IoT services exist, the number of requests increases as the number of services running simultaneously increases. Therefore, the load congestion may occur at the sink node, and it is necessary to distribute the load. In this paper, we have proposed a cloud-based load distribution model, implemented it using Cefore, and evaluated the load characteristics of the proposed method. As a result, we were able to distribute the load compared to the conventional method. The results clearly show that the proposed method can be applied to environments where multiple IoT services exist in a single sensor network.
